An Advanced Skill Certificate in Plant Molecular Biotechnology provides specialized training in cutting-edge techniques used to improve crop yields, enhance nutritional value, and develop disease-resistant plants. This program equips students with the practical skills necessary to succeed in this rapidly evolving field.
Learning outcomes for this certificate typically include mastering molecular biology techniques like gene cloning, gene editing (CRISPR-Cas9), and plant transformation. Students gain proficiency in analyzing genomic data, understanding plant physiology at a molecular level, and applying bioinformatics tools for research and development. A strong foundation in plant genetics is also developed.
The duration of the Advanced Skill Certificate in Plant Molecular Biotechnology varies depending on the institution, but generally ranges from six months to one year of intensive study. This condensed timeframe allows for focused learning and quick entry into the job market.
